How to use 'Equal to' in set expression?

hi,

Could you please let me know how to use “equal to” in the set expression.

eg. I have a region column and wana take only those region which i want to see in the list . How do i do that?

eg. for NOT EQUAL we use '<>' so for EQUAL what we can use in set expression?

sunny_talwar

I would just do like this:

{<Region = {'Region1', 'Region2', 'Region3'}>}

sunny_talwar

In the load script, you can try this:

LOAD YourFieldNames,

FROM

Where Match(Region, 'Region1', 'Region2', 'Region3');
